Key Pavement Characteristics Identified from the Field Trial of Sustainable Carbon Mastic Asphalt

Dr. Hanwen Cui, CPEng, RPEQ, JP is a practicing Civil Engineer in Queensland Department of Transport and Main Roads, working on the delivery of infrastructure construction and maintenance projects, including batter slope remediation, pavement re-surfacing, and road safety projects. He graduated from UNSW with a PhD in Civil Engineering, investigating nature-based eco-friendly hydraulic structures and multi-phase flows. He also established himself in the field of sustainable construction materials and geotechnical engineering through academic research. His current
research interests are sustainable hydraulic structures, resilient construction materials, pavement, geotechnical engineering, and road safety. Hanwen holds a position as Office Bearer in EA Queensland Civil College, and he is dedicated to leverage the interface between policy, academia and industry to deliver innovative solutions to challenging practical problems.
